数据库实时流计算场景,实时数据库原理

数据库实时流计算场景,实时数据库原理

生离死别 2024-12-24 行业应用 63 次浏览 0个评论

引言

随着大数据时代的到来,数据量的爆炸式增长对数据处理能力提出了更高的要求。数据库实时流计算作为一种新兴的技术,能够对实时数据流进行高效处理和分析,为企业和组织提供了强大的数据处理能力。本文将探讨数据库实时流计算的场景、优势以及应用实例。

什么是数据库实时流计算

数据库实时流计算是一种处理和分析实时数据流的技术,它能够实时捕捉数据源的变化,对数据进行处理和分析,并快速响应。这种计算模式通常基于分布式计算框架,如Apache Kafka、Apache Flink等,能够处理大规模的数据流,并支持高吞吐量和低延迟的计算。

数据库实时流计算的场景

数据库实时流计算在多个场景中发挥着重要作用,以下是一些典型的应用场景:

  • 金融交易监控:在金融领域,实时流计算可以用于监控交易数据,及时发现异常交易行为,防止欺诈活动。

  • 物联网数据分析:物联网设备产生的海量数据可以通过实时流计算进行分析,为用户提供个性化的服务和建议。

  • 社交网络分析:实时流计算可以分析社交媒体数据,了解用户行为和趋势,为营销策略提供支持。

    数据库实时流计算场景,实时数据库原理

  • 智能交通系统:实时流计算可以处理交通数据,优化交通信号灯控制,减少交通拥堵。

  • 电子商务推荐系统:实时流计算可以分析用户行为和购买历史,为用户提供个性化的商品推荐。

数据库实时流计算的优势

相较于传统的批处理模式,数据库实时流计算具有以下优势:

  • 低延迟:实时流计算能够对数据进行实时处理,延迟通常在毫秒级别,满足对实时性要求较高的应用场景。

  • 高吞吐量:实时流计算能够处理大规模的数据流,支持高吞吐量的数据处理。

  • 可扩展性:实时流计算框架通常支持水平扩展,能够适应数据量的增长。

  • 容错性:实时流计算框架具备高容错性,能够在节点故障的情况下保证系统的稳定运行。

    数据库实时流计算场景,实时数据库原理

应用实例

以下是一些数据库实时流计算的应用实例:

  • 阿里巴巴的实时推荐系统:阿里巴巴利用实时流计算技术,对用户行为和商品信息进行实时分析,为用户提供个性化的商品推荐。

  • 腾讯的实时广告投放:腾讯利用实时流计算技术,实时分析用户行为和广告效果,优化广告投放策略。

  • 百度地图的实时路况分析:百度地图利用实时流计算技术,分析实时交通数据,为用户提供准确的实时路况信息。

结论

数据库实时流计算作为一种新兴的技术,在处理和分析实时数据流方面具有显著优势。随着技术的不断发展和应用场景的拓展,数据库实时流计算将在更多领域发挥重要作用,为企业提供强大的数据处理能力,助力他们在大数据时代取得竞争优势。

你可能想看:

转载请注明来自江苏安盛达压力容器有限公司,本文标题:《数据库实时流计算场景,实时数据库原理 》

百度分享代码,如果开启HTTPS请参考李洋个人博客
Top